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 622884 - Unmask net-misc/iputils-20161105
Summary: Unmask net-misc/iputils-20161105
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: Normal normal (vote)
Assignee: Gentoo's Team for Core System packages
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2017-06-28 03:14 UTC by Jason A. Donenfeld
Modified: 2017-11-17 09:19 UTC (History)
2 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Jason A. Donenfeld gentoo-dev 2017-06-28 03:14:24 UTC
I'd like to use this newer version easily. It's quite stable and has some nice fixes. It's been masked for over two years, so perhaps by now it can be unmasked?
Comment 1 David Heidelberg (okias) 2017-08-18 22:17:43 UTC
I'm afraid this is political decision :(

As a maintainer of https://github.com/iputils/iputils I offered over email and after that publicitly on ML original maintainer full-access to github development, TravisCI and Coverity reports, but he didn't responded, just in 2015 randomly released some updated version without most of patches...

Well, these days most dists use up-date github version, only Gentoo masked it for some reason I'd like to know.
Comment 2 Zhixu Liu 2017-09-07 04:40:45 UTC
$ ping ...
PING ... 56(84) bytes of data.
WARNING: kernel is not very fresh, upgrade is recommended.

I have seen this warning for many years, and it had been fixed in 2014 (https://github.com/iputils/iputils/commit/5bb0f0a8b0ed6f111a329c0d6911dfa516ab1d42), so I'd like to use the newer version too, thanks.
Comment 3 Thomas Deutschmann (RETIRED) gentoo-dev 2017-10-28 15:16:10 UTC
The two iputils-2016* ebuilds had some install issues depending on selected USE flags.

After updating the live ebuild where I fixed these issues I decided to create a newer snapshot release instead.

=net-misc/iputils-20171016_pre should now be available, unmasked.
Comment 4 Zhixu Liu 2017-11-17 03:45:10 UTC
it's still masked as of 20171117
Comment 5 Thomas Deutschmann (RETIRED) gentoo-dev 2017-11-17 06:00:16 UTC
(In reply to Zhixu Liu from comment #4)
> it's still masked as of 20171117
No? =net-misc/iputils-20171016_pre was added via https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=698832458c8639ad939bf5743a91cb512029707c and the mask only affects ~~net-misc/iputils-2016* (https://gitweb.gentoo.org/repo/gentoo.git/tree/profiles/package.mask#n686):

>  $ eshowkw net-misc/iputils
> Keywords for net-misc/iputils:
>                    |                                 |   u   |
>                    | a a         p   a     n r     s |   n   |
>                    | l m   h i   p   r m m i i s   p | e u s | r
>                    | p d a p a p c x m i 6 o s 3   a | a s l | e
>                    | h 6 r p 6 p 6 8 6 p 8 s c 9 s r | p e o | p
>                    | a 4 m a 4 c 4 6 4 s k 2 v 0 h c | i d t | o
> -------------------+---------------------------------+-------+-------
>        20121221-r1 | + + + + + + + + + ~ + o o + + + | 4 # 0 | gentoo
>        20121221-r2 | ~ ~ ~ ~ ~ ~ ~ ~ ~ ~ ~ o o ~ ~ ~ | 4 #   | gentoo
>        20151218    | + + + + + + + + + ~ + o o + + + | 5 o   | gentoo
>     [M]20160308    | ~ ~ ~ ~ ~ ~ ~ ~ ~ ~ ~ o o ~ ~ ~ | 5 #   | gentoo
>     [M]20161105    | ~ ~ ~ ~ ~ ~ ~ ~ ~ ~ ~ o o ~ ~ ~ | 5 #   | gentoo
> [I]20171016_pre    | ~ ~ ~ ~ ~ ~ ~ ~ ~ ~ ~ o o ~ ~ ~ | 6 o   | gentoo
>        99999999    | o o o o o o o o o o o o o o o o | 6 o   | gentoo
> 

Looks like you are using a _very_ outdated Gentoo repository.
Comment 6 Zhixu Liu 2017-11-17 06:53:06 UTC
(In reply to Thomas Deutschmann from comment #5)
> Looks like you are using a _very_ outdated Gentoo repository.

I mean it's not marked as stabled yet.
Comment 7 Thomas Deutschmann (RETIRED) gentoo-dev 2017-11-17 09:19:06 UTC
This is a complete new version (new version, new upstream) with a rewritten ebuild which was added on 2017-10-28. We haven't passed Gentoo's default 30 days waiting period yet. Either keyword on your own for your system(s) if you can't wait any longer or just be patient. We won't start stabilization before end of November.